What Is Prepare/Enrich?

Prepare/Enrich is a personalized online assessment for engaged, dating, and married couples. Rather than offering generic advice, it identifies the particular strengths and potential areas for growth within your relationship.

The assessment explores important areas such as:

  • Communication

  • Conflict resolution

  • Personality differences

  • Financial expectations

  • Affection and intimacy

  • Family backgrounds

  • Relationship roles

  • Stress

  • Spiritual beliefs

  • Marriage expectations

  • Parenting expectations

There is no passing or failing. The purpose is not to judge your relationship or predict your future. It is to give you greater awareness and help you have important conversations before marriage.

What the Process Includes

1. Complete the assessment

Each partner completes the confidential online assessment independently. Your responses are combined into a personalized report highlighting areas of agreement, relationship strengths, and topics that may need further conversation.

2. Review your results together

We will meet to explore your results in a supportive and constructive setting. I will help you understand the report, identify recurring relationship patterns, and discuss the areas most relevant to your future marriage.

3. Practice essential relationship skills

Insight is valuable, but lasting relationships also require practical skills. Depending on your results, our sessions may include exercises addressing communication, conflict, stress, emotional connection, finances, family relationships, and shared goals.

4. Create a foundation for continued growth

You will leave with a better understanding of one another, practical tools you can continue using, and a clearer sense of the marriage you want to build together.

Catholic Marriage Preparation

For Catholic couples, Prepare/Enrich offers a Catholic version of the assessment that includes questions related to faith, prayer, participation in the life of the Church, family planning, and raising children.

When desired, I can approach the process through a Catholic understanding of marriage as a lifelong covenant and sacrament. This provides space to discuss not only how you will live together, but also the spiritual meaning and vocation of your marriage.

Prepare/Enrich facilitation may complement your parish or diocesan marriage-preparation requirements. Because requirements vary, couples should confirm with their parish whether this process will be accepted as part of their formal preparation.

Couples who are not Catholic, or who come from different religious backgrounds, are also warmly welcomed. The process will be adapted to your beliefs, values, and circumstances.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many sessions will we need?

Most couples complete the process in approximately four to eight sessions. The exact number depends on your assessment results, goals, and any parish or marriage-preparation requirements.

Is Prepare/Enrich couples therapy?

Prepare/Enrich is primarily an assessment, feedback, and relationship-education process. If deeper concerns emerge, we can discuss whether couples counseling or another form of support would be appropriate.

Can we fail the assessment?

No. Prepare/Enrich is not a test of whether you should get married. It is designed to increase awareness, highlight strengths, and identify areas where further conversation and skill-building may be helpful.

Can married couples use it?

Yes. Prepare/Enrich can also help newly married and long-married couples understand their relationship patterns, reconnect, and work intentionally on areas of growth.
